The resonant absorption of solar axions by 57Fe nuclei, which is accompanied by the excitation of the first excited nuclear level: A + 57Fe → 57Fe*→ 57Fe + γ(14.4 keV), is sought. To seek 14.4-keV photons, a Si(Li) detector and an enriched 57Fe target are used. The detector and target are placed in a low-background setup equipped with passive and active shieldings. As a result, a new upper limit m A ≤ 360 eV (at 90% C.L.) has been determined for the axion mass.
